As the Partner Development Executive (BNL), reporting to the Partner Development Lead, you will be responsible for the proactive recruitment, onboarding, development, and GP growth of focused publishers on the Awin network. Your role will be focused on three main areas: Strategic Publisher Development, Revenue Generation, and Network Expansion.
Job Responsibility:
Manage relationships with assigned publishers and key stakeholders
Research growing verticals within the Awin network and develop a pipeline of new publishers to contact and onboard to network
Working closely with the other Publisher Development teams, identify and seamlessly launch high-potential publishers into complementary Awin markets
Provide regular reporting to publishers, internal teams, and relevant customers
Work closely with the wider UK & European Publisher Development teams to expand publisher coverage and coordinate regional expansion and publisher optimisation projects
Maintain and develop standardized Partnership Development processes to be utilized across the group
Support the implementation and development of new reporting and operational processes
Support marketing teams with case studies and content creation
Communicate effectively and professionally with publishers, vendors and internal teams via email, phone and face-to-face
Coordinate and host dynamic in-office sessions that bring publishers together with client-facing teams, fostering collaboration and stronger partnerships
Attend in office and external meetings and events when requested
